What Constitutes Assault with a Deadly Weapon

Assault with a deadly weapon is defined as an unlawful attempt or threat to inflict bodily injury using a weapon that can cause serious harm. This includes firearms, knives, or any object used in a manner that could be lethal. Understanding this definition helps frame the legal issues involved.

Key Elements and Legal Procedures in These Cases

The prosecution must prove the use of a deadly weapon and intent to harm. Legal procedures involve investigation, evidence gathering, and negotiation or trial phases. Our firm guides clients through each step to ensure informed decisions and robust defense strategies.

Important Terms and Glossary

Familiarity with legal terminology aids in understanding your case and the defense process. Below are key terms commonly encountered in assault with a deadly weapon charges.

Deadly Weapon

An object capable of causing death or serious bodily injury when used as a weapon.

Intent

The purpose or resolve to carry out a particular act, especially to cause harm.

Felony

A serious crime usually punishable by imprisonment for more than one year.

Self-Defense

A legal justification for using force to protect oneself from imminent harm.

Tips for Navigating Assault with a Deadly Weapon Charges

Act Quickly and Secure Legal Counsel

Promptly contacting an experienced attorney helps preserve evidence and build a strong defense. Early action can influence case outcomes positively.

Avoid Discussing Your Case Publicly

Refrain from speaking about your case on social media or with acquaintances to prevent unintended admissions or misunderstandings that can be used against you.

Be Honest with Your Attorney

Providing full and truthful information allows your lawyer to prepare the most effective defense strategy tailored to your situation.

What is considered a deadly weapon under California law?

A deadly weapon is any object capable of causing serious bodily injury or death when used as intended or in a threatening manner. This includes firearms, knives, and sometimes everyday objects used dangerously. Understanding this helps clarify the specific charges involved.
